Understanding RTP: The Player’s Long-Term Edge
Understanding RTP: The Player’s Long-Term Edge
Let’s cut through the noise: RTP, or Return to Player, isn’t a promise of what you’ll win on your next spin, or even your next session. It’s the statistical bedrock, a calculated projection of what the game is engineered to give back over millions, perhaps billions, of theoretical spins. Think of it as the house edge, but flipped on its head,a 96.5% RTP slot mathematically retains $3.50 for the casino from every $100 wagered across its entire lifespan. That’s the long game. For you, the punter chasing online pokies real money Australia offers, this figure is your most crucial compass. It signifies potential longevity. A higher RTP doesn’t ignite more frequent wins in the short term; it simply suggests that, theoretically, your bankroll might navigate a more protracted and engaging journey before that inevitable statistical gravity takes hold. Volatility Explained: Balancing Risk and Reward
Volatility Explained: The Engine Behind Every Spin
Let’s cut to the chase: volatility, often called variance, is the heartbeat of a slot machine’s personality. It doesn’t dictate your long-term return,that’s the RTP’s job-but it absolutely governs the rhythm of your bankroll. Think of it as the climate of a game. Low volatility is a temperate, predictable drizzle of smaller wins. High volatility? That’s the arid desert, punctuated by sudden, torrential downpours of cash. You’ll endure long, parching stretches where the reels seem barren, a test of patience where your balance can slowly ebb. Then, out of nowhere, a single spin can trigger a chain reaction of bonus features or a colossal symbol combination, delivering a payout that can be multiples of your bet. It’s this brutal tension between drought and deluge that defines the experience.

Bonus Buy and Jackpot Games: Where High Volatility Pays Off
The Allure of the Instant Trigger: Bonus Buy & Progressive Jackpots
For the Australian punter whose patience wears thin spinning for that elusive free games round, or whose dreams are measured in life-changing sums, the high-octane worlds of Bonus Buy features and progressive jackpot games present a tantalising, albeit ferociously volatile, alternative. These mechanics fundamentally reshape the traditional slot experience, trading the slow burn of accumulated gameplay for a direct, often costly, ticket to the main event. The “Bonus Buy” option, now ubiquitous among many hot RTP slots in the high-volatility niche, allows you to bypass the base game entirely. For a premium,typically 70x to 100x your bet,you purchase immediate access to the slot’s bonus feature. It’s a high-stakes gamble: you’re investing a significant chunk upfront, betting that the bonus round’s potential will not just cover that cost but deliver substantial profit. The thrill is instantaneous. The calculation is brutal.
Parallel to this are the siren calls of networked progressive jackpots, the digital descendants of the classic pub online pokies real money Australia dream. Here, volatility isn’t just high; it’s stratospheric. A minuscule portion of every wager across a network of linked games feeds a central, ever-climbing prize pool, often reaching millions. Winning such a jackpot usually requires maximum bet and landing a specific, extraordinarily rare combination.
